What is a housekeeping associate?

Housekeeping Associates are professionals responsible for maintaining cleanliness and order in various settings such as hotels, hospitals, offices, and private residences. Their duties typically include cleaning rooms, making beds, replenishing supplies, and ensuring that all areas meet established standards of sanitation and presentation. Housekeeping Associates play an essential role in creating a comfortable and safe environment for guests, patients, or residents. They often work as part of a team and may also report maintenance issues or assist with laundry services as needed.

What are some common challenges faced by housekeeping associates and how can they be addressed?

Housekeeping Associates often encounter challenges such as managing time effectively to complete tasks within tight schedules, handling physically demanding work, and maintaining high standards of cleanliness during busy periods. To address these, many teams implement efficient workflow systems, provide ergonomic tools, and offer training on best practices for cleaning and organization. Open communication with supervisors and colleagues also helps distribute workloads evenly and ensures any issues are quickly resolved.

What is the difference between Housekeeping Associate vs Room Attendant?

AspectHousekeeping AssociateRoom Attendant
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; on-the-job trainingHigh school diploma or equivalent; on-the-job training
Work EnvironmentHotels, resorts, hospitals, commercial facilitiesHotels, resorts, hospitality industry
Employer & Industry UsageCommonly used in hospitality and healthcare sectorsPrimarily in hotels and resorts
Job FocusGeneral cleaning, maintaining cleanliness of facilitiesCleaning guest rooms, making beds, replenishing supplies

Both roles involve cleaning and maintaining cleanliness in hospitality settings. A Housekeeping Associate typically performs broader cleaning tasks across various areas, while a Room Attendant focuses specifically on guest rooms. The credentials and work environments are similar, making these titles often interchangeable depending on the employer.
